    I own a house in Tobyhanna and am making improvements in preparation to sell. My experience with…read moreHome Depot was mixed: 1). Carpet and kitchen floor measurements (Poor) Home Depot requires that they measure rooms to order flooring. You can't measure it yourself. The wait for an appointment was over a week. The first appointment was cancelled at the last minute because the person called in sick. I had to wait another week for an appointment. The second appointment was cancelled at the last minute because the person called in sick. The measuring was done on the 3rd try. Total time elapsed was over 3 weeks. 2). First Carpet Installation Job (great) No problems with carpet installation. Carpet looks great. Price reasonable. 3). Kitchen floor (great) I had vinyl plank flooring installed. It came out great. Installation went well. Price reasonable. The delivery process was somewhat inconvenient. The installer could not bring the tiles to be installed. They had to be delivered separately. The first delivery attempt was cancelled because there was a moderate amount of snow in the driveway. I drove over it with no problem. Delivery was made ob second attempt. 4). Second Carpet Order (Totally Unsatisfactory / Order Cancelled) I ordered carpets for 2 additional bedrooms. 10 days later I've been calling to followup on order and try to schedule installation. Home Depot has problems finding the order. Says it doesn't exist even though I have receipt and charge to my credit card. Phone calls are dropped. Call backs are agreed to and don't happen. I just disputed the $2,000+ order charges with my credit card company. I spoke to Pam in flooring and she agreed to email me the measurements that I paid for so I can give them to another vendor. She agreed. No email was sent. Home Depot is affordable, but can be very difficult to work with if you need a project done quickly. I live in Delaware and am only near the East Stroudsburg store when I'm visiting my Tobyhanna House. Dealing with them by phone is a nightmare.

    This gaming store is located on Main Street in downtown East Stroudsberg. With Spider-Man and a…read moresmiling Pikachu beckoning from the main window display, it's hard not to walk in and check it out. Inside the store, the first area to greet you is board games, with options for different game styles and interests available. Pretty ok selection for reasonable prices. Towards the middle of the store is the cash register area on the right with collectors' "weapons" displays overhead for safe keeping and display. To the left is a section with American DC/Marvel comics and a small shelf of manga. Further back is a smaller, more specific modeling and other comic related section, followed by open tables in the back for Magic and other card games. Terrific idea to incorporate tables for player interaction and provide a space for gamers to enjoy games in person. In the very back is an e-sports area with consoles and computers set up. When I visited, these weren't in use, but good idea for non-covid times. I also noticed signs posted up for special game nights on certain days a week, for example one sign listed a Pokémon weekly game night. Covid-related: staff wore masks as did most of the patrons. There is a sign on the door requesting customers to wear face coverings. There did not seem to be a limit on # of people in the store, and when I was there on a Saturday early afternoon there was probably around 10 people in the front section of the store and about a dozen seated in the game-play area in the back.
